Output 993eacbf6aa0008bc1569f038fd164ccb383635b496927cc0e361ef33f0457cb:3

value
1567192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eee6b2054280bae5ebe14e2ce6177f4acd5de6e3 OP_EQUAL
address
3PUD7CLa8Zm5w4XoqMu6wsVr3ta9eDRhsU
transaction
993eacbf6aa0008bc1569f038fd164ccb383635b496927cc0e361ef33f0457cb
confirmations
321590
spent
true